Introduction to the Langara Student Success Course (LSSC)

 

The LSSC is a free, 9-module mini-course on Brightspace that prepares students for academic life at snəw̓eyəɬ leləm̓ Langara. The LSSC is available 24/7 and can be completed in 5-7 hours.

By instructors sharing information about the LSSC, we anticipate being able to reach more students, resulting in more students completing the LSSC and being well prepared to meet academic expectations in your courses.

Course Completion and CGPA

Analysis by residency status from Spring 2018 to Spring 2023
For more details, visit the Tableau Cloud site.

CGPA

Spring 2018 – Spring 2023

Domestic students:

  • Passed – 3.09
  • Failed – 2.68
  • Did not participate – 2.42

International Students:

  • Passed – 3.18
  • Failed – 2.42
  • Did not participate – 2.23

LSSC Student Information Sessions

Safe and Inclusive Space

The Langara Student Success Course is committed to Equity, Diversity, and Inclusion. We strive to make this a welcoming, safe, and inclusive environment for all learners.

Since fall 2020, we have hosted optional LSSC student information sessions for the first few weeks of the course and semester. We collaborate with students and colleagues across the college to offer relevant and timely information for a strong start to the semester.

Sessions include:

  • The LSSC & Getting Ready for the Semester
  • LSSC Student Ambassadors Panel
  • Academic Integrity and Misconduct
  • Effective Groupwork
  • Making the most of the Academic Success Centre & Library

I'm thrilled by LSSC's impact on students and my classes. I offer 5% bonus marks for successfully completing it and have found that students who complete LSSC are typically more successful in my course, join more extracurricular activities, and get more from their college experience. I worried that LSSC would require extra work but was pleasantly surprised – it shows up automatically in new students' Brightspace course list, and all I need to do is announce it and add the 5% bonus to final grades; everything else is handled by the LSSC team. LSSC offers the wonderful benefits of happier, more engaged students who understand what's expected of them and how to get help. They feel supported, fit in better, and know how to succeed. In my opinion it's one of the best services we offer to our students.

Lucinda Atwood, instructor, Business Management & International Business
